In this role, you will lead the development of primary and secondary packaging concepts rooted in deep consumer insights to deliver superior, people-centered experiences. You will drive growth and profitability by identifying and expanding opportunities through emerging consumer trends, breakthrough technologies, and innovative methodologies. The primary objective of this position is to navigate the end-to-end development cycle—from identifying opportunity spaces through prototyping and scale-up—ensuring every solution is both consumer-centric and environmentally responsible.
  • Responsibilities
  • + •
Strategic Innovation Scouting:
  • Proactively assesses packaging opportunities from new and emerging suppliers while collaborating with Procurement to evaluate the viability and business impact of proposed concepts. +
  • People-Centered Design:
  • Partners with Marketing and Consumer Insights to prioritize ergonomics and user needs in the design phase, serving as the lead engineer responsible for solving complex technical challenges as projects progress. +
  • Rapid Prototyping & Iteration:
  • Employs rapid prototyping to drive a fast "test-and-learn" environment, embracing iterative development and learning from failures to accelerate the innovation pipeline. +
  • Financial & Cost Modeling:
  • Manages the financial components of development by generating accurate Total Delivered Cost (TDC) data and providing the rationale for funding required to meet project goals. +
  • Sustainable Decision Support:
  • Delivers evidence-based recommendations for packaging changes that balance consumer desirability with technical feasibility, cost-efficiency, and end-of-life sustainability trade-offs.
  • Required Qualifications
  • + Bachelor's degree in Packaging, Engineering, Industrial Design, or a related field.
+ 5+ years of engineering experience in a global food or fast moving consumer goods company. + At least two years of specialized experience in packaging development. + Strong project management skills with a proven ability to independently manage timelines and deliver on multiple deadlines simultaneously. + Must provide a portfolio containing non-confidential packaging projects showcasing direct experience in the development process.
  • Preferred Qualifications
  • + Master's degree in Packaging, Engineering, or Industrial Design.
+ Foundational understanding of packaging sustainability concepts, specifically regarding design-to-disposal trade-offs. + Demonstrated ability to navigate cross-functional teams and find pathways to advance projects despite high levels of uncertainty or ambiguity. + Deep curiosity and openness to experimenting with new tools, methods, and emerging technologies beyond current industry practices.
